Also, STO's first content patch is coming out shortly. They don't have a definitive date but it'll be coming between today and the end of the month.

http://www.startrekonline.com/season_one

PVP Updates
* Wargames – Federation players can now participate in PvP against one another to better prepare for the dangers of the battlefield.
* New PvP Map – Explore “Shanty Town,” a brand new Ground Assault map available for both Klingon and Federation players.

Customization
* Off-Duty Uniforms – Experience DS9 in style! Starfleet officers will have the option to change into off-duty outfits to enjoy more casual attire.
* New Stances and Hairstyles – Further customize your Captain by changing his or her hairstyle, or adopting two brand new stances: Stern and Relaxed.
* The Captain's Log - A web-based application to check in on you and your friends' Captains and ships.

Ships
* A New Klingon Battle Cruiser – The K’Tanco Battle Cruiser has been made available to Klingon Lieutenant Commanders.
* Klingon Ship Customization - Use the ship tailor to customize your Bird of Prey, Carrier or Raptor.

Missions
* New Fleet Actions Everywhere!
o The Big Dig – Available in Romulan space.
o DS9 Under Siege - The True Way has attacked and boarded DS9. Repel the invasion to save the day.
o Klingons Can Play, Too – Klingon Captains may now access the Crystalline Entity, Big Dig and Breaking the Planet Fleet Actions

Skills
* Respec Is Here – Unhappy with your Captain’s skill point allocation? Use the respec tool to change things up. (Available both in-game and as a C-store item.)
* New Skill: Starship Attack Vectors – Improve your ship’s accuracy and critical hit chance.
* New Skill: Combat Maneuvers – Improve your ship’s evasion and turn rate.
* New Skill: Starship Battle Strategy – Improve your ship’s critical hit severity and damage resistance.

In The C-Store
* New Bridge Variants - All new ways to update your Bridges’ look, available for a low price in the C-Store for both Federation and Klingon ships.
* Federation Ship Variants – New takes on your old favorites, available for a low price in the C-Store.
* Respec - Unhappy with your Captain’s skill point allocation? Use the respec tool to change things up.
* Character Slot - Purchase an additional character slot if you'd like to have more than three characters on your account.
* Rename - Changed your mind about the cool name you chose? Get it legally changed! Recognized across the Alpha Quadrant.
* New Federation Playable Species - Become a Tellarite, Pakled or Rigelian.
